About Slobodan Djukanović
Slobodan Djukanović is a scholar working on Signal Processing, Control and Systems Engineering and Civil and Structural Engineering, having authored 55 papers that have together received 884 indexed citations. Recurring topics across this work include Advanced Electrical Measurement Techniques (17 papers), Machine Fault Diagnosis Techniques (15 papers) and Structural Health Monitoring Techniques (12 papers). The work is most often cited by research in Signal Processing (193 citations), Control and Systems Engineering (225 citations) and Aerospace Engineering (235 citations). Slobodan Djukanović has collaborated with scholars based in Montenegro, United Kingdom and Serbia. Frequent co-authors include Igor Djurović, Marko Simeunović, Ljubiša Stanković, Vesna Popović–Bugarin, Miloš Daković, Tomo Popović, Nedeljko Latinović, Božo Krstajić, Žarko Zečević and Ana Pešić. Their work appears in journals such as IEEE Transactions on Signal Processing, IEEE Access and IEEE Transactions on Aerospace and Electronic Systems.
